FF

Frank Flores

Vice President, Engineering (Retired) at Northrop Grumman

VP Engineering VP
f***@ngc.com Sign up
Pro only
Pro only
Pro only
Las Vegas, Nevada, United States

Company Details

Company: Northrop Grumman
Industry: defense & space
Employees: 97000
Revenue: 41033000000
HQ Location: Falls Church, Virginia, United States
Company LinkedIn: Pro only
VP level · VP Engineering